Description

The Sungrow MG6RL Hybrid Inverter is a 6kW high-performance residential solution designed for reliability and efficiency. It offers seamless backup power (switching in under 4ms), 200% peak power for 10 seconds, and advanced battery management. With dual pressure relief, AFCI protection, and a wide MPPT voltage range supporting 20A PV input per string, it ensures safe and flexible operation. The 4.3-inch touchscreen, multiple communication ports, and remote monitoring make system control simple and intuitive.


Key Features:

  • 6kW rated AC output power with full backup capability
  • Seamless backup switching (< 4 ms) for uninterrupted power
  • 200% peak output power for up to 10 seconds
  • Maximum 20A PV input current per string
  • Wide MPPT operating voltage range (40 – 425 V)
  • Supports whole-home backup with 40A bypass switch
  • Smart control interface for generators, smart loads, or microinverters
  • Dual-system pressure relief for PCS and AFCI protection
  • Natural convection cooling with IP65 protection
  • 4.3-inch LCD touchscreen with optional Wi-Fi or Ethernet communication

Technical Specifications:

Specification MG6RL
Recommended Max. PV Input Power 12,000 Wp
Max. Usable PV Input Power 9,600 Wp
Max. PV Input Voltage 500 V
Startup / Min. PV Input Voltage 50 V / 40 V
Rated PV Input Voltage 360 V
MPPT Operating Voltage Range 40 V – 425 V
Number of MPPT Trackers 2
Max. PV Input Current 40 A (20 A per string)
Battery Type Lithium-ion
Battery Voltage Range 40 V – 60 V
Max. Charge / Discharge Current 135 A
Max. Battery Charge / Discharge Power 6,000 W
AC Output Power (Grid Mode) 6,000 W
Max. Apparent Power 6,000 VA
Rated AC Output Voltage 220 V / 230 V / 240 V
AC Voltage Range 154 V – 276 V
Frequency 50 Hz / 60 Hz
Grid Frequency Range 45 – 55 Hz / 55 – 65 Hz
Harmonic Distortion (THD) < 3%
Power Factor > 0.99 at rated output
Max. Output Power for Backup Load 6,600 W
Backup Mode Voltage / Frequency 220 / 230 / 240 V
Peak Output (10 seconds) 2x rated power (up to 13,200 W)
Switching Time to Backup Mode ≤ 4 ms
Max. Efficiency / European Efficiency 97.6% / 96.7%
Cooling Method Natural convection
Protection Features DC reverse polarity, AC short-circuit, leakage current, PID, surge protection (DC Type II / AC Type II), AFCI (optional)
Degree of Protection IP65
Display 4.3′ LCD digital touchscreen & LED indicator
Communication CAN, RS485, Ethernet (optional), WLAN (optional)
Dimensions (W x H x D) 536 mm × 386 mm × 210 mm
Weight < 18 kg
Mounting Wall-mounted
Ambient Temperature Range -25°C to +60°C
Certifications IEC 62109-1/-2, IEC 61000-6-1/-3, IEC 62116, NRS 097-2-1, MEA, PEA, DEWA
